In �950, MAGOTTEAUX developed the first cast chromium balls in its foundry located in Vaux, Belgium. Today, the Group produces more than 250,000 tonnes per annum of grinding media and wear parts, in specialized production units located in major global markets.

MAGOTTEAUX continues to develop solutions to fight against wear mechanisms met in crushing, grinding and pyro-processing applica-tions, and now offers, over �50 alloys created from special chemical compositions and heat treatments. THE RANGE OF MAGOTTEAUX CAST BALLS

MAGOTTEAUX offers a unique variety of grinding media that combine the following characteristics :

. size : from �2 to �25 mm (from ½”to 5”),

. chromium percentage of the alloys : from 0,5 to �5%,

. heat treatment cycles.

The media can be classified in 5 main categories each of which has a specific brand name with an individual reference in each particular field of application:

THE CHOICE OF THE MEDIA DEPENDS UPON:. the material to be ground and its granulometry, . the grinding process,. the relative importance of the wear mechanisms to be dealt with (abrasion, corrosion, impact),. the factors influencing these mechanisms.

MASTERING WEAR MECHANISMS

Whatever your application, MAGOTTEAUX can carry out a full analysis, suggest an adapted solution and ensure its follow up. This procedure is the result of thousands of practical case studies. This on-site work, carried out in close partnership with the customer, has allowed our teams, worldwide, to deepen and develop their knowledge and know-how.

OUR MOTTO : “THE RIGHT PRODUCT FOR THE RIGHT APPLICATION”.

To finalize the choice of the RP/RA , MAGOTTEAUX also uses specialist tools, installations and technologies to monitor wear rates. These are :

. Marked Ball Tests, . Wear pilot stations, . Ball and pulp level monitoring system for wet grinding, the SENSOMAG®, . Automatic ball loading machine, the MAGOLOAD®.
